Types of Fireplaces

Before diving into particular products, it's essential to understand the various kinds of fireplaces offered in the UK:

Fireplace TypeDescription
Wood-Burning FireplacesTraditional fireplaces that burn logs. They need a flue and produce a lot of heat, creating a rustic atmosphere.
Gas FireplacesThese provide instantaneous heat and can be turned on or off with a flick of a switch. Ideal for convenience and typically come in a series of styles.
Electric FireplacesThese are plug-in devices that imitate the look of genuine flames. They are easy to set up and can be used in homes without a chimney.
Bioethanol FireplacesEnvironment-friendly choices that burn bioethanol fuel, producing heat without smoke or ash. Perfect for modern, modern spaces.
Inserts and StovesFireplaces inserted into existing structures or standalone ranges that burn wood or gas, using efficiency and heat retention.

Things to Consider When Choosing a Fireplace

Choosing the right fireplace requires factor to consider of different aspects:

  1. Type of Fuel: Choose between wood, gas, electrical, or bioethanol depending on your choices and home setup.
  2. Size of Your Room: The fireplace should be sufficient to warm your space efficiently. Little rooms may only need a compact design.
  3. Style and Aesthetics: The fireplace must complement your home's décor. Traditional designs might suit older homes, while contemporary designs fit modern areas.
  4. Installation: Some fireplaces, like electrical ones, need minimal setup, while others may need a flue or chimney.
  5. Spending plan: Set a budget that includes setup costs if essential, together with the rate of the fireplace.

Maintenance Tips for Fireplaces

To guarantee your fireplace operates effectively and safely, think about the following upkeep tips: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ean the fireplace, chimney, or vent routinely to avoid soot buildup and guarantee correct airflow.
  2. Yearly Inspections: Have an expert examine your wood-burning or gas fireplace annually for safety and effectiveness.
  3. Fuel Storage: Store wood or other fuel in a dry area, far from the fireplace, to prevent wetness and mold.
  4. Usage Quality Fuel: Always use suggested fuel types for your fireplace to prevent damage and inadequacies.
